    Sorry to be 'that guy' but what is the tire spec on this truck? I thought that with the +4 offset on the TRD wheels that 285's would clear the upper control arms. Would I need to go to a 0 or neg offset wheel to clear 285's? I'm trying to avoid spacers on my 1st gen. Thanks and nice work!

    • @jmcg_8
      @jmcg_8 Год назад

      It's my understanding that 4.5 inches of backspacing is minimum required. 8" wide wheel would need to be -6. But I think these are less than 8" wide, aren't they?

    • @shaun77r
      @shaun77r Год назад

      Pretty sure those wheels are more like a +15mm offset, which is why they need spacers for 285's. They sit really tight and with the 285's they're just high enough that at full lock they rub on the UCA. They'll prob rub the frame too. Regardless, these 1st gens are so awesome. Miss mine. This one looks super clean! Well done!

    • @BasilsGarage
      @BasilsGarage  Год назад +2

      It was REALLY close, the tire had about 1/4" clearance to the UCA at full lock. I also forgot to mention it but the tire was close to the ADS resi, so the spacers helped clear both! We probably could have gotten away without them, but rather play it safe, plus, the little bit wider stance fills out the wheel wells perfectly.
